How Does HDHubFU Work?
HDHubFU functions similarly to other piracy websites. It does not host the actual content but acts as an index of download links and streaming portals. Here’s how it works:
-
Scraping Content: HDHubFU scrapes content from various sources, including torrent websites and unauthorized screen recordings.
-
Hosting Links: Instead of storing content, it hosts download and streaming links from third-party servers.
-
Revenue Generation: The platform earns through popup ads, redirects, and sometimes malicious links, making it risky for the average user.
-
Frequent Domain Changes: Due to frequent takedowns and legal scrutiny, HDHubFU often switches domains to stay active.

Is HDHubFU Legal?
The short answer is no.
HDHubFU operates in clear violation of international copyright laws by distributing content without permission from rights holders. Many countries, including the U.S., India, and the U.K., have strict laws that criminalize both the uploading and downloading of pirated material.
While legal actions are more commonly taken against operators of such websites, users are not entirely immune. In some jurisdictions, even streaming pirated content can result in fines or legal notices.
